Reconstruction:Proto-Indo-Iranian/HlawpaHćás
Proto-Indo-Iranian
Etymology
Perhaps from Proto-Indo-European *h₂lewpéh₂-ḱo-s (“fox-like”), from *h₂lewpéh₂-s ~ *h₂lewph₂-és (“fox”) + *-ḱos, from *h₂lewp- (“fox”). Cognate with Ancient Greek ἀλώπηξ (alṓpēx), Proto-Italic *wolpis, Lithuanian lãpė, Latvian lapsa, Old Armenian աղուէս (ałuēs), Luwian [script needed] (ulipna-), [script needed] (walipna-).

Descendants
- Proto-Indo-Aryan: *HlawpaHśás
- Sanskrit: लोपाश (lopāśá) (see there for further descendants)
- Proto-Iranian: *HrawpaHcáh[2] (see there for further descendants)
- Proto-Nuristani:
- Waigali: laüsa (borrowed from Iranian?)
- → Proto-Germanic: *rebaz
- → Proto-Uralic: *repäs
